NP/PA – Orthopedic Surgery
Fargo, ND
Discover an exciting opportunity at Essentia Health Fargo by joining our expanding orthopedic team. Our team consists of 4 surgeons, 1 orthopedic medicine physician, and 6 Advanced Practice Providers (APPs), all supported by skilled athletic trainers, cast technicians, and nursing staff. You'll also have the chance to assist with our walk-in clinic.
Become part of a dynamic and collaborative environment that thrives in a high-volume setting. We are looking for candidates who can serve as surgical assistants alongside their clinical duties, with a preference for those with an Orthopedic Surgery background or experience.
Key Highlights
- Full-time position (1.0 FTE)
- Enjoy a variable schedule with 0-2 OR days and 3-5 clinic days per week (generally known 60 days in advance)
- This position offers a well-rounded experience supporting multiple members of the surgical team during add-on surgery days, with the potential to be paired with an incoming surgeon to assist on their designated OR days
- Leadership is open to supporting flexible scheduling options, including 4x10-hour shifts, 4x9-hour shifts with one 4-hour day, or other alternative arrangements
- Clinic volumes vary based on experience and comfort, allowing you to grow into your practice
- Anticipated outreach to satellite hospitals/clinics; specific locations and days to be determined
- Responsibilities include patient care coordination, OR assistance, inpatient rounding, supporting physicians' practices, APP call support, and assisting with the walk-in clinic
- Preference for candidates with an Orthopedic Surgery background or experience

Education/Training
- Master’s or Doctorate degree in Nurse Practitioner or Bachelor’s/Master’s degree in Physician Assistant program from an accredited program/institution.
- Current licensure as a registered nurse in appropriate states (if NP).
- Current licensure as a Nurse Practitioner or Physician Assistant in appropriate states.
- Current certification in CPR
- National certification, in applicable area.
- Successful completion of Essentia Health credentialing process prior to practice.
